I was never a fan of Karl Kirkpatrick but in a sort of parting shot interview I read somewhere he has a go at the number of penalties being given these days and says he was proud to only give 6 in his last GF appearance. His attitude was (he says) to penalise the blatant offences and give the benefit of the doubt to the other less obvious technical infringements. He also quoted Mo when he said "We are in the entertainment business" meaning the game was the entertainment not the ref as he also thinks the refs are not invisible enough since going full time.Not for the first time I say full time refs have had a detrimental effect - it's as if they now believe they have to be more involved when really they should be trying to be invisible.
